Hi, we just got a '73 Charger SE yesterday. This one is for my wife's DD. It's a 400 with a fair cam in it so we'll see how that goes. Interior is really nice. We need a dash cap and that's about it. It had an electric fuel pump under the hood. Not good. Was running rough and backfiring, got a little better on the 70 mile drive home but we put on a new mechanical and problem solved.
It has a little rust in one side in a quarter panel and a ding from a deer but underneath it looks great. Headers, new exhaust with flowmasters, cragers and BFG t/a's. New radiator, electric fan (she hates that) and pretty clean under the hood overall. Needs shocks.
